Output fd812066b17ae61e300da23354ab2752148abe1230409b0677f31453311766c2:0

value
1420732
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d69f5f84748656247d89791c0186c735804902dc OP_EQUAL
address
3MFqT2uLBv82EkHs1DyDi1BnaGApbCVvUw
transaction
fd812066b17ae61e300da23354ab2752148abe1230409b0677f31453311766c2
spent
true